What do you call a rabbit's home?
In the wild, a rabbit's home is called a warren, which is comprised of a system of burrows where rabbits live. A domesticated rabbit's home is called a hutch, which is basically a wire cage. Wire floors in a hutch will hurt a rabbit's feet, so a piece of wood should be used as flooring in a hutch.
